关于美国的叙述正确的是(    )

A.首都纽约是全国最大的城市

B.世界最大的农产品出口国,不需要进口任何农产品

C.居民以黑种人为主

D.世界上最发达的工业国家

答案

答案:D

美国的首都是华盛顿,其最大城市是纽约,A选项错误。美国是世界上农业最发达的国家,是世界上最大的农产品出口国,但由于其热带面积狭小,需大量进口热带经济作物,B选项错误。美国居民以白种人为主,C选项错误。美国是世界上最发达的工业国家。所以本题选择D选项。
